TPWallet 添加 keystore/文件 全面教程与安全架构解读

摘要:本文以 TPWallet 添加文件(常见为 keystore/JSON 文件或钱包导入文件)为切入点,逐步给出操作要点,并从安全支付服务、智能化数字化路径、资产显示、高科技数字化转型、实时数字监控和安全通信技术六个维度做全面解读与最佳实践建议。

1. 理解“添加文件”的范畴

“文件”通常指:keystore/JSON 私钥文件、助记词导出文件、硬件备份文件或合约 ABI/代币元数据文件。其本质是用来恢复账户或补充钱包显示信息。操作前须明确文件类型及来源。

2. 基础操作步骤(通用注意事项)

- 准备:在离线或安全环境下处理敏感文件,关闭不必要网络、禁用截图。备份到受信任的加密介质并多重备份。

- 验证:确认文件来源与完整性,校验哈希或签名,确保不是被注入的恶意文件。

- 导入:打开 TPWallet,选择“导入钱包/恢复钱包”→ 选择 keystore/JSON 或对应类型→ 输入文件与密码→ 本地解密并导入。Android/iOS 页面可能不同,谨遵官方引导。

- 校验显示:导入后核对地址、交易历史与代币余额,确认一致。

3. 安全支付服务(Security Payment)

- 身份与授权:启用密码、指纹/面容识别、额外 PIN,使用多因素认证(MFA)降低被盗风险。推荐结合硬件钱包或钱包Connect进行签名。

- 支付策略:使用白名单、限额、交易预签名策略、二次确认(短信或独立审批设备)来保障大额交易安全。支持多签或阈值签名(MPC)以实现企业级安全支付服务。

4. 智能化数字化路径

- 自动识别与元数据:TPWallet 可通过代币合约自动抓取代币符号、精度与图标;支持通过 ABI/JSON 文件补充自定义代币信息。结合链上数据和价格预言机实现智能展示。

- 自动化规则:定期扫链、触发器(余额变动、交易失败)与策略(gas 优化、交易重试)构成智能化运营路径。

5. 资产显示与用户体验

- 可视化:显示各链资产汇总、单币种持仓、法币估值与历史净值曲线。确保代币小数点处理正确、防止显示误差。

- 可定制化:支持按标签分组、自定义代币添加(通过合约地址或 ABI 上传文件),并提供价格来源选择(多预言机备选)。

6. 高科技数字化转型

- 基础设施:采用云原生与边缘计算、微服务架构,CI/CD 与自动化测试保证版本质量;对关键密钥操作引入 HSM/SGX/MPC 等硬件或安全执行环境。

- 数据治理:链上/链下数据分层存储,敏感信息加密,访问审计与合规流水可追溯。

7. 实时数字监控

- 监控要素:钱包余额、未确认交易、合约调用失败率、异常签名请求。通过 websocket 或链节点订阅实现实时告警。

- 异常检测:基于规则与 ML 的异常行为检测(短时间内大量转账、黑名单地址交互等),并触发冻结或人工审批流程。

8. 安全通信技术

- 传输层:全部接口强制 TLS1.2/1.3,使用现代加密套件,服务器端证书管理与自动更新。

- 端到端与消息签名:关键消息采用消息签名、时间戳和防重放机制。移动端可使用证书绑定或证书钉扎(pinning)减少中间人风险。对于敏感同步,考虑端到端加密。

9. 风险与合规建议

- 永不在网络环境下明文传输 keystore/助记词。对企业用户建议采用多签或托管服务并结合 KYC/AML 流程。

- 定期安全评估与第三方审计,针对导入与签名流程进行渗透测试。

10. 简要检查清单(导入前后)

- 文件哈希/签名校验

- 环境隔离与备份

- 生物/密码保护启用

- 导入后地址/余额核对

- 开启实时监控与告警

结语:添加文件看似简单,但涉及私钥与账户恢复的操作对安全要求极高。将技术性步骤与企业级安全服务、智能化路径与实时监控结合,能显著降低风险并提升资产可视化与可控性。

作者:林泽发布时间:2025-12-08 18:17:21

评论

小明

写得很实用,尤其是关于 keystore 校验和多签的建议,受益匪浅。

Ava_88

讲得系统又细致,关于实时监控的部分很适合企业落地,感谢分享。

区块链老王

建议再补充一下不同链导入差异以及常见错误排查步骤,会更全面。

Neo

对安全通信和证书钉扎的强调很到位,希望能出一篇实践配置指南。

相关阅读
<u date-time="tygrkl"></u><del id="w7diiu"></del><strong lang="2y7tjm"></strong><var id="4xyxwd"></var><center draggable="7oxkpq"></center><map lang="ddabxi"></map><b dropzone="vqxgko"></b><address lang="fphatx"></address>